Soulful and driven, T-Bird & The Breaks strut to the tune of southern funk. The miniature big band has a serious feel for funk and dance and has attained a strong local following in their hometown of Austin, Texas. Lead by gravelly, strong-voiced T-Bird, and backed by a band of horns, tight backup singers, a steady rhythm section and varied guitar techniques, Harmonizum (to be released January, 2015) is a grooving throwback to funk roots. A feel-good record of 11 original tracks and a cover of Elvin Bishop’s “Fooled Around And Fell In Love.”
